MC145422DW-MC145422P-MC145426DW-MC145426P
Universal Digital-Loop Transceiver
---The MC145422 and MC145426 UDLTs are high–speed data transceivers
that provide 80 kbps full–duplex data communication over 26 AWG and larger
twisted–pair cable up to two kilometers in distance. Intended primarily for use in
digital subscriber voice/data telephone systems, these devices can also be
used in remote data acquisition and control systems. These devices utilize a
256 kilobaud modified differential phase shift keying burst modulation technique
for transmission to minimize RFI/ EMI and crosstalk. Simultaneous power
distribution and duplex data communication can be obtained using a single
twisted–pair wire.
These devices are designed for compatibility with existing, as well as
evolving, telephone switching hardware and software architectures.
The UDLT chip–set consists of the MC145422 Master UDLT for use at the
telephone switch linecard and the MC145426 Slave UDLT for use at the remote
digital telset and/or data terminal.
The devices employ CMOS technology in order to take advantage of their
reliable low–power operation and proven capability for complex analog/digital
LSI functions. Provides Full–Duplex Synchronous 64 kpbs Voice/Data Channel and Two
8 kbps Signaling Data Channels Over One 26 AWG Wire Pair Up to Two
Kilometers Compatible with Existing and Evolving Telephone Switch Architectures and
Call Signaling Schemes Automatic Detection Threshold Adjustment for Optimum Performance Over
Varying Signal Attenuations Protocol Independent Single 5 V Power Supply 22–Pin PDIP, 24–Pin SOG Packages Application Notes AN943, AN949, AN968, AN946, and AN948
MC145422 Master UDLT
Pin Controlled Power–Down and Loopback Features Signaling and Control I/O Capable of Sharing Common Bus Wiring with
Other UDLTs Variable Data Clock — 64 kHz to 2.56 MHz Pin Controlled Insertion/Extraction of 8 kbps Channel into LSB of 64 kbps
Channel for Simultaneous Routing of Voice and Data Through PCM Voice
Path of Telephone Switch
MC145426 Slave UDLT
Compatible with MC145500 Series PCM Codec–Filters Pin Controlled Loopback Feature Automatic Power–Up/Power–Down Feature On–Chip Data Clock Recovery and Generation Pin Controlled 500 Hz D3 or CCITT Format PCM Tone Generator for
Audible Feedback Applications
